NEIDERT v. UN. COMP. BD. OF REV.

No. 1747 C.D. 1981.

69 Pa.Commw. 344 (1982)

Ronald E. Neidert, Petitioner v. Commonwealth of Pennsylvania, Unemployment Compensation Board of Review, Respondent.

Commonwealth Court of Pennsylvania.

October 13, 1982.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Harold Tull, for petitioner.

Charles G. Hasson, Assistant Counsel, with him Richard L. Cole, Jr., Chief Counsel, for respondent.

Submitted on briefs to Judges ROGERS, CRAIG and MacPHAIL, sitting as a panel of three.


OPINION BY JUDGE CRAIG, October 13, 1982:

Affirming a referee's decision, the Unemployment Compensation Board of Review denied claimant Ronald Neidert benefits because it found that he had terminated his employment with the Commonwealth's Department of General Services (department) voluntarily and without cause of a necessitous and compelling nature.1
